A Conversation with Alex Haley

Author Alex Haley is best remembered for his novel, Roots, an historical drama based on his family’s history. Roots later became an epic mini-series portraying in poignant detail the realities of slavery.
I had a number of conversations/interviews with Alex over the years. As Providence would have it, the last interview I had with him was just days before his death. Interestingly enough he sent me this letter of commendation subsequent to our interview:

“Scott Ross?  You’d have a hard time finding a greater combination of street smarts, on – camera savvy and born – again gentleman.” 

I received this letter the day Alex died. It very well could have been one his final writings!
Previously, I had the opportunity to talk with him at his Alabama farm before Haley’s death in 1992. In this fascinating interview, Alex Haley discusses controversial topics like hate, racism within the black community, and affirmative action. Some of his responses might surprise you and many of the issues we discussed are still relevant today.
